Labor Radio Podcast Network Expands to 60 members in 4 countries


Labor Radio Podcast Network Expands to 60 members in 4 countries


IMMEDIATE RELEASE

AUGUST 26, 2020


Launched in April, the Labor Radio Podcast Network has recently expanded to over sixty labor related shows in four countries. The voices of the working class often get overlooked in the corporate-controlled media. The goal of the network is to help raise the voices of working people and organized labor to demand and achieve better treatment from workplaces and elected officials.

“The explosive growth in members of the Labor Radio Network in a few short months is testament to a movement that will continue to expand in the coming months and years,” said Network founder and producer Chris Garlock.

The Labor Radio Podcast Network is both a one-stop shop for audiences looking for labor content and a resource for labor broadcasters and podcasters. Resources include a weekly podcast summarizing shows produced by network members, marketing on social media, a website listing network shows and how audiences can find them, a database for contacting expert guests, access to a private listserv for Network members, and a weekly video call to increase solidarity and support amongst members.
